Lucknow. Rashtriya Lok Dal (RLD) President Jayant Chaudhary on Monday filed his nomination for the Rajya Sabha in the presence of Samajwadi Party President Akhilesh Yadav. Jayant Choudhary may be the owner of movable and immovable assets worth more than Rs 52 crore but he does not own a car or two wheeler. He is not fond of gold and silver. He also has liabilities of Rs 2.48 crore.
According to the affidavit filed by RLD President Jayant Choudhary on Monday while filing nomination for the Rajya Sabha elections, Jayant himself has movable assets worth Rs 6.69 crore and immovable assets worth Rs 36.30 crore. His wife Charu Singh has movable assets worth Rs 2.94 crore and immovable assets worth Rs 2 crore.
RLD President Jayant Chaudhary’s two daughters Sahira and Elisha are also millionaires. Sahira has movable and immovable assets worth Rs 2.44 crores while Elisha has assets worth Rs 2 crores. Talking about cash, Jayant has only 12 thousand rupees while wife Charu has two lakh rupees. Charu also has jewelery worth Rs 30 lakh. Jayant, who did his MSc Accounting and Finance from the London School of Economics and Political Science, does not have a single criminal case registered against him.
After completing the nomination process at the Vidhan Bhavan on Monday, Jayant Chaudhary expressed his gratitude to Akhilesh and other parties of the alliance, describing it as his honor to be sent to the Rajya Sabha. He said that he will raise the voice of the farmers and youth of UP in Parliament. At the same time, he once again reiterated his promise to fight the 2024 Lok Sabha elections with Akhilesh Yadav.
Jayant Chaudhary said that ‘I hope that the way the alliance has been fighting strongly, we will move forward with the same solidarity. I thank Akhilesh Yadav and all the workers of the alliance. The blessings given by the people and the SP alliance will always be remembered. As a representative of UP, I will strongly raise the issues here.
In the elections to be held on June 10 for 11 Rajya Sabha seats in Uttar Pradesh, SP is fielding its candidates on three seats. SP has made Jayant Chaudhary the joint candidate of the SP-RLD alliance. Apart from Jayant, the SP has fielded Kapil Sibal and Javed Ali Khan, who were Union ministers in the UPA government, who left the Congress party. Both of them have already made their nominations.
